What is data preprocessing?

Data preprocessing is the process of cleaning, transforming, and organizing raw data into a usable format for analysis or machine learning. It involves steps such as handling missing values, removing duplicates, normalizing or scaling data, and encoding categorical variables. Proper data preprocessing helps improve the quality and performance of predictive models by ensuring the data is accurate, consistent, and suitable for analysis.

What is the difference between Data Preprocessing vs Data Analysis?

AspectData PreprocessingData Analysis
Primary FocusCleaning, transforming, and preparing raw data for analysisInterpreting data to extract insights and support decision-making
Skills RequiredData cleaning, scripting, understanding of data formatsStatistical analysis, data visualization, critical thinking
Work EnvironmentData engineering teams, data science projectsBusiness intelligence, research, data science teams
Tools UsedPython, R, SQL, ETL toolsExcel, Tableau, R, Python, statistical software

While data preprocessing involves preparing raw data for analysis by cleaning and transforming it, data analysis focuses on interpreting the prepared data to uncover trends and insights. Both roles are essential in the data pipeline but serve different purposes in the data lifecycle.

What are some common challenges faced in a Data Preprocessing role, and how can they be effectively managed?

Professionals in Data Preprocessing often encounter challenges such as handling incomplete or inconsistent data, managing large datasets, and ensuring data quality before analysis. Addressing these issues typically involves using specialized tools to automate data cleaning, establishing clear data validation rules, and collaborating closely with data engineers and analysts. Staying updated with best practices and leveraging scripting languages like Python or R can also streamline the preprocessing workflow, making it easier to deliver reliable and accurate datasets for downstream analysis.
